Web5 jun. 2024 · 5 June 1849: King Frederick VII (r. 1848-63) makes Denmark a constitutional monarchy with his signature on the country’s first constitution, the Grundlov, which established two chambers for the legislature, introduced key civil rights, and granted 15% of the population the right to vote. The Grundlov remains the foundation of Danish democracy. WebThe Danish monarchy is one of the oldest in the world and one of the most firmly established and popular institutions in Denmark. Denmark is a constitutional monarchy, which means that the monarch cannot independently perform political acts.
